首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在执行addEventListener()函数之前,请等待所有动态脚本源标记加载完毕

在执行addEventListener()函数之前,请等待所有动态脚本源标记加载完毕。

在前端开发中,当我们需要在页面加载完毕后执行某些操作时,可以使用addEventListener()函数来监听DOMContentLoaded事件。然而,如果页面中存在动态加载的脚本,我们需要确保这些脚本加载完毕后再执行相关操作,以避免出现错误。

为了解决这个问题,我们可以使用以下方法来等待所有动态脚本源标记加载完毕:

  1. 使用Promise对象和DOMContentLoaded事件:
  2. 使用Promise对象和DOMContentLoaded事件:
  3. 这种方法通过创建一个Promise对象,并在DOMContentLoaded事件触发时resolve该Promise对象,从而实现等待动态脚本加载完毕的效果。
  4. 使用MutationObserver:
  5. 使用MutationObserver:
  6. 这种方法通过使用MutationObserver来监听DOM树的变化,当有新的节点添加到DOM树中时,检查是否有动态脚本被添加,并在有动态脚本加载时执行相关操作。

这些方法可以确保在执行addEventListener()函数之前等待所有动态脚本源标记加载完毕,从而避免出现相关错误。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的合辑

领券